  • What are the top attractions in McKinney, TX for solo travelers?

    McKinney has a lot to offer solo travelers! The Heard Museum is a great place to spend a few hours, and the historic downtown area is perfect for strolling around and checking out the shops and restaurants. If you're looking for something a little more active, the Erwin Park Nature Center has trails for hiking and biking.

  • Where can budget travelers find cheap local food in McKinney, TX?

    For cheap eats, head to the McKinney Farmers Market on Saturday mornings. You'll find local vendors selling fresh produce, baked goods, and other snacks. There are also a few good Mexican restaurants in the area that offer affordable lunch specials.

  • What pros and cons come with booking a motel in McKinney, TX?

    Motels in McKinney are usually a good value, and they're often located in convenient spots near the highway. The downside is that they might not have the same amenities as a hotel, like a pool or fitness center. Some motels might also be a bit older and could use some updating.
  • What are the less known or hidden attractions in McKinney, TX?

    You might want to check out the Chestnut Square Historic Village, which is a collection of historic buildings that showcase the city's past. If you're interested in art, the McKinney Avenue Contemporary is a great place to see local artists' work.
